Background
The submersible pump is an important device for pumping water from a deep well. When in use, the whole unit is submerged to work, and underground water is extracted to the ground surface, so that the unit is used for domestic water, mine emergency, industrial cooling, farmland irrigation, seawater lifting and ship load regulation, and can also be used for fountain landscape. The hot water submersible pump is used for hot spring bathing, can also be suitable for extracting underground water from deep wells, and can also be used for water extraction projects such as rivers, reservoirs, water channels and the like. The water-saving device is mainly used for farmland irrigation and water for people and livestock in high mountain areas, and can also be used for central air-conditioning cooling, heat pump units, cold pump units, cities, factories, railways, mines and construction sites for water drainage. The general flow can reach 5-650 m3The delivery lift can reach 10-550 m.
According to a immersible pump hoisting device of patent No. CN202671061U, when overhauing, do not have good fixed means to the submerged motor pump, it is inconvenient to operate, overhauls more difficult.

Referring to fig. 1-3, the present invention provides a technical solution: a quick disassembly and maintenance device for a submersible electric pump comprises a fixed frame 1, a supporting frame 2 is fixedly connected to the left side of the fixed frame 1, a steering motor 3 is fixedly connected to the top of the fixed frame 1, a connecting rod 4 is fixedly connected to one side of the steering motor 3, the bottom of the connecting rod 4 is connected with a steel wire rope 5 through fixed pulley transmission, a tool placing frame 6, a fixed block 7, a connecting block 8 and an elastic air bag 9 are respectively and fixedly connected to the top of the supporting frame 2, a bearing plate 10 is slidably connected to the inner cavity of the fixed block 7, a reset spring 11 is fixedly connected to the top of the connecting block 8, one end, far away from the connecting block 8, of the reset spring 11 is fixedly connected with the bottom of the bearing plate 10, the top of the elastic air bag 9 is fixedly connected with the bottom of the bearing plate 10, an inserting rod 12 is movably connected to the top of the fixed block 7, and the bottom end of the inserting rod 12 penetrates through the top of the fixed block 7 and extends to the inner cavity of the fixed block 7, the inner chamber of fixed block 7 is equipped with the inserting groove of sliding connection with the surface of inserting rod 12, the fixed surface of inserting rod 12 is connected with adapter sleeve 13, one side swing joint of adapter sleeve 13 has connecting rod 20, connect connecting rod 20 into adapter sleeve 13 earlier, link connecting rod 20 and inserting rod 12 together, then insert inserting rod 12 into the inserting groove at fixed block 7 top, fix inserting rod 12 in the four corners of submerged motor pump, then rotate butt threaded rod 15, butt threaded rod 15 stretches out and butts in the surface of submerged motor pump, spacing submerged motor pump, maintain through the instrument of placing above instrument rack 6, the operation is convenient, high durability and convenient use, can be quick fix the maintenance to the submerged motor pump, the one end of connecting rod 20 runs through one side of adapter sleeve 13 and extends to the opposite side of adapter sleeve 13, the fixed surface of connecting rod 20 is connected with roof 14, one side of the top plate 14 is in threaded connection with an abutting threaded rod 15, one end of the abutting threaded rod 15 penetrates through one side of the top plate 14 and extends to the other side of the top plate 14, one side of the support frame 2 is fixedly connected with an air pump 16 and a hook 17 from top to bottom respectively, the surface of the air pump 16 is communicated with an air gun 18, the surface of the hook 17 is movably connected with a cleaning brush 19, when the cleaning brush 19 is detached, dirt on the connection position of submersible electric pump components is cleaned, then air is supplied through the air pump 16, dirt on the surface of the submersible electric pump is blown away through the air gun 18, the submersible electric pump is cleaned, tools are complete, the submersible electric pump can be quickly cleaned before maintenance, sludge is prevented from entering the submersible electric pump after detachment, four fixing blocks 7 are arranged, the centers of the bearing plates 10 are symmetrically distributed, a plurality of connecting blocks 8 are arranged, and are evenly distributed at the bottom of the bearing plate 10.
The using method of the detection device comprises the following steps:
the method comprises the following steps that firstly, a submersible electric pump is pulled up through a steel wire rope 5, then the submersible electric pump is conveyed to the position above a bearing plate 10 through a steering motor 3, then the submersible electric pump is put down, the submersible electric pump falls on the bearing plate 10, the submersible electric pump falls down, the bearing plate 10 is extruded to enable the bearing plate to slide downwards along a fixing block 7 to respectively extrude a return spring 11 and an elastic air bag 9, and the submersible electric pump is placed on the upper portion;
step two, when the submersible electric pump is disassembled, the cleaning brush 19 is taken down from the hook 17, dirt at the joint of the submersible electric pump component is brushed off, air is supplied through the air pump 16, the dirt on the surface of the submersible electric pump is blown off through the air gun 18, and the submersible electric pump is cleaned;
step three, when overhauing, in earlier pegging graft into adapter sleeve 13 with connecting rod 20, link together connecting rod 20 and grafting rod 12, then peg graft into the inserting groove at fixed block 7 top with grafting rod 12 in, fix the four corners at submerged motor pump with grafting rod 12, then rotate butt threaded rod 15, butt threaded rod 15 stretches out the conflict at submerged motor pump's surface, and is spacing to submerged motor pump, maintains through the instrument of placing in instrument rack 6 top.
